Mr. Speaker, I salute the bill, because for the first time in 150 years, it recognizes the importance of rebuilding overfished stocks by creating a legal duty to develop plans, et cetera. However, I understand that this will be left to the regulations. While I understand that it is often useful to provide more detail, I wonder if the member shares my concern that it may never come to pass if those regulations are never enacted.
